Florida International vs Rice Prediction and Odds - 12 February 2023

Florida International faces Rice in college basketball action at Ocean Bank Convocation Center on Sunday, beginning at 11:00am AEDT.

Stats Insider's top betting tips for Florida International vs Rice, as well as the latest betting odds in Australia, are detailed in this article.

Who will win? Florida International vs Rice

Based on trusted computer power and data, Stats Insider has simulated Sunday's Florida International-Rice college basketball game 10,000 times.

Our independent predictive analytics model currently gives Florida International a 60% chance of winning against Rice at Ocean Bank Convocation Center.

Florida International vs Rice Best Bets

Stats Insider's predicted final score for Florida International vs Rice at Ocean Bank Convocation Center on Sunday has Florida International winning 78-74.

This prediction is based on each team's average score following 10,000 game simulations.
